Pricing: $35 / Month

EXCLUSIVE: Optimus Futures customers can take advantage of $0.20 per contract routing fees with either the Core ($35 monthly fee) or the Advanced ($200 monthly fee) non-professional packages. Customers that meet the CME’s definition of Professional must choose between Pro Core and Pro Advanced pricing. Pro Core has a $25 monthly fee, $0.50 per contract routing fee, $500 cap, and includes 50 free contracts. Pro Advanced has a $200 monthly fee, $0.50 per contract routing fee, $500 cap, and includes 400 free contracts.

 

General Overview of Trading Platform

The CTS T4 platform offers professional trading functionality at a competitive price. CTS T4 includes futures and options market data, execution, position management, and charting. It was originally designed for brokers and locals on the trading floor, but has adapted and grown to offer more functionality for all kinds of traders. Newly added enhanced mobile apps provide excellent functionality when you’re away from your desk.

 

CTS T4 Charting

CTS T4 offers day charts down to tick charts as well as an extensive number of studies and indicators. Custom script editing allows for unique studies to be written and implemented in any chart. Charts are responsive, customizable and offer different bar styles such as candlestick, Heikin Ashi, Renko, and point and figure. Continuous contract charts are offered that combine data from the most active expirations going back several years. Exchange listed spreads are included and custom spread charts, such as gold vs crude oil, may be created with the TradeSniper add-on.

CTS T4 Execution

CTS T4 offers one-click DOM trading, chart trading, order tickets, and price prompt order entry. Every window that displays market data supports at least one order entry method. Advanced order types such as multi-exit bracket (OCO) orders, activation orders, and MOC orders are available. Buttons that cancel all working orders and flatten open positions let you quickly reduce exposure. Revisions and cancellations are handled easily through a filtered order book.

CTS T4 User Interface

While it isn’t the prettiest platform on the market, CTS T4 isn’t lacking in functionality. It’s a user friendly, intuitive trading platform. Each window is self-contained, allowing for multiple charts, DOMs, etc. to be arranged in any layout desired. Workspaces can span multiple monitors and can be saved to CTS servers, allowing for the same view upon login from any computer. Mobile apps are custom built to take advantage of Android and iOS touch functionality and offer an extra degree of freedom in trading.

 

Education & Training

CTS provides in-office demos as well as one-on-one remote webinar sessions to get customers familiar with the platform. Support staff is available during business hours to assist with any questions and night support is available for emergencies. Videos are posted on YouTube and an extensive user guide is available online.
